Expectations

At Cirque Dance Studio, Ms. Lisa believes great dancers are built through commitment, consistency, teamwork, and joy. Every class is designed to help dancers grow not only in technique, but also in confidence, discipline, and respect for one another. To create the best possible experience for every dancer, she ask families to honor the following expectations:

Student Code of Conduct

Attendance Matters

Consistent attendance is one of the most important parts of a dancer’s success. Dance classes work as a team, and when dancers are frequently absent, it affects choreography, spacing, formations, timing, and the progress of the entire class. Regular attendance allows dancers to build strong fundamentals, confidence, and trust within their group.

Master the Fundamentals

Strong technique is the foundation of every successful dancer. We encourage dancers to stay disciplined, work hard, and continually improve their flexibility, strength, musicality, and overall performance quality.

Be On Time & Prepared

Arriving on time and ready for class helps dancers start focused and prepared to learn. Proper dancewear (your class color & black bottoms), shoes, and a positive attitude are expected each week so every class can begin smoothly and productively.

Have Fun & Encourage Others

Dance should be a place where students feel inspired, supported, and excited to grow. We value kindness, teamwork, encouragement, and creating a positive environment where every dancer feels confident to shine.

Meet Mrs. Lisa Hunter

ms.lisa

I personally teach every class and love that I get to watch them grow into dancers. 

​

I offer combination classes so that you can participate in dance and still have time for school, sports, church, and family. 

​

We’ll put on a spectacular show every year where they’ll leave the stage feeling confident and proud. No need to worry, I’m very careful that all music, movement, and costumes are appropriate.

 

The dancers receive a trophy of completion each year and there are many opportunities to receive special awards to recognize hard work, potential, and talent, as well as scholarships!
